Who needs CCTV - Portsmouth City?

01
Businesses: CCTV systems are often essential for businesses to ensure the safety and security of their premises. Retail stores, banks, restaurants, and other establishments that deal with valuable goods or hold sensitive information can greatly benefit from CCTV surveillance.
02
Residential Areas: Some residential areas or apartment complexes may install CCTV systems to enhance security and deter criminal activities. This can provide residents with peace of mind and act as a deterrent against potential intruders.
03
Public Spaces: CCTV systems may also be installed in public spaces such as parks, parking lots, or transportation hubs to monitor activities, detect potential threats, and increase public safety.
04
Government Buildings: Government institutions, including civic centers, libraries, or administrative offices, may have CCTV systems installed to protect their staff, visitors, and important assets.
05
Educational Institutions: Schools, colleges, and universities may opt for CCTV systems to improve the safety and security of students, teachers, and campus facilities.
06
Healthcare Facilities: Hospitals, clinics, and other healthcare establishments may have CCTV systems to monitor entrances, parking areas, and other critical areas to ensure patient and staff safety.
07
Traffic and Transportation: CCTV systems are commonly used to monitor traffic flow, detect accidents, and enforce traffic regulations to enhance road safety.
It is important to note that the need for CCTV - Portsmouth City may vary based on individual circumstances and requirements. Consult with local authorities or relevant professionals to determine the specific needs and regulations applicable to your situation.
